
Bean Kentucky Blue Pole, AAS
50-75 Days to maturity. Non-GMO, annual, open-pollinated, high-yielding, AAS Winner, drought and heat tolerant, pole, snap string bean. Resistant to Bean Common Mosaic Virus (race 1) and Rust. Kentucky Blue Pole Beans are a remarkable variety that combines the best traits of the classic 'Kentucky Wonder' and 'Blue Lake' pole beans. This hybridization results in a bean that is not only high-yielding but also offers exceptional flavor and tenderness. Yet, the plants are open-pollinated! The vines can reach impressive heights of 6 to 8' requiring sturdy support structures like trellises or poles. The beans are long, slender, and deep green, typically reaching 6 to 7". They are stringless and have a sweet, tender flavor, perfect for fresh eating, canning, or freezing. ~89 seeds/oz.
